PROTESTATIONS OF INNOCENCE

Each of the suspects' acting is now tested to the limit as they read their final Protestation of Innocence from their Character Booklet.  This is their last chance to persuade the Investigators (and each other) that they are innocent of the murder.  By this time the character(s) who is guilty of the crime will have been informed of this fact in their Character Booklet, so they will be genuinely lying.

ACCUSATIONS

After three minutes thinking time, the Chief Investigator goes round the room, asking everyone to name the person(s) they think are guilty.  After everyone has voiced their opinion, the Chief Investigator goes round a second time, asking why they have come to that conclusion.  This method prevents a person altering their opinion after the have heard someone else's convincing deductions.

At this point the actual killer(s) will have to come up with a convincing accusation against an innocent suspect.

Once everyone has explained their choice and reasons, it is time for the Chief Investigator to take centre stage and make the Dramatic Denouement!
